Lemon
A-Freak-A b/w Chance To Dance (12")
Prelude Records (US) / 1978 / PRL D 157
12" Disco single 33 ⅓ rpm vinyl record
Producer, Arranger, Conductor: Kenny Lehman
Mixer/Remixer : Kenny Lehman and (Francis K) François Kevorkian
Vocals: Gordon Grody, Diva Gray, Lani Groves, Kenny Lehman, Luther Vandross and David Lasley
Side A
1. A-Freak-A (7:30)
(Kenny Lehman, Steve Boston)
Side B
1. Chance To Dance (7:42)
(Kenny Lehman, Steve Boston)
Due to contractual reasons, the Kenny Lehman group Lemon also appeared on Salsoul at around the same time with "Freak On" as a yellow colored vinyl 12 inch single.

Kenny Lehman co-wrote the songs for this freakin' Prelude label disco group.
LEMON was originally signed to Salsoul for an initial single "Freak on" (some 12" copies are on lemon coloured vinyl!). Kenny features playing the flute; Luther Vandross sings backing vocals.
"Chance to dance" is a great disco number especially the 12'' remixed by François K, who is still very active on the dance scene today !
